Çankaya is a municipality and district of Ankara Province, Turkey. [2] Its area is 483 km 2, [3] and its population is 942,553 (2022). [1] It is home to many government buildings, including the Grand National Assembly of Turkey, as well as nearly all foreign embassies to Turkey. Çankaya is a cosmopolitan district and considered the cultural and financial center of Ankara.

Söğütözü is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of Çankaya, Ankara Province, Turkey. [1] Its population is 5,668 (2022). [2] It is located between the Eskişehir Road (D-200 Eskişehir Yolu) and Atatürk Forest Farm and Zoo. Its postal code is 06510. [3]

Kızılay is the city center of Ankara Province in the municipality and district of Çankaya, Turkey. [1] Its population is 1,311 (2022). [ 2 ] It is named after the Kızılay Derneği (Turkish Red Crescent) whose former headquarters was located at the Kızılay Square .
Gaziosmanpaşa is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of Çankaya, Ankara Province, Turkey. [1] Its population is 3,621 (2022). [2] It is just south of the city center of Ankara. Several embassies accredited to the Republic of Turkey are situated here.
